loneranger , see if there is any markings on the two terminals.

But likely there won't be any. However, look for this small diode that is connected to either one of the terminals. One terminal would have it, the other without.

The terminal with the extra diode would be the +ve terminal.

loneranger , for me, i would just connect the 2 terminals, and flick the switch on. If it turns on, then you've got the terminals right.

If it does not turn on, then immediately flick the switch back off. Change the polarity of the terminals and you'll be done.

The battery with reversed polarity would hardly or even damage the player, as the voltage is very low. So i won't worry about it damaging the player should the terminals be wrong. Just don't charge the player with the wrong terminals and the player would be fine.
